The ingredients needed to make No Knead Seed bread - recipe from Nadia Lim website.:
  1. Get 1 tbsp Godern Syrup or Hone
  2. Take 2 cup boiling water
  3. Get 1 tbsp dry granulated yeast
  4. Prepare 450 grams high-grade flour
  5. Get 450 grams Wholemeal Flour (you can use spelft flour or buckwheat flour)
  6. Take 2 tsp salt
  7. Take 3 tbsp wheatgerm
  8. Prepare 1/2 cup sunflower seeds
  9. Make ready 1/2 cup pumpkin seeds
  10. Prepare 1/4 cup extra pumkin seeds and sunflower seeds to garnish

Instructions to make No Knead Seed bread - recipe from Nadia Lim website.:
    1. Mix golden syrup or honey, water and milk together. Sprinkle yeast over and stand for 5 minutes until frothy.
    1. Combine dry ingredients and make a well in the centre. Pour in the yeast mixture, and mix together well. The mixture will have a sticky consistency.
    1. Divide dough into two well-oiled loaf tins and sprinkle some more pumpkin and sunflower seeds over top.
    1. Put loaf tins into a cold oven, and turn temperature to 50 degC/122 Fahrenheit. Leave for half an hour ? this is when the bread begins rising. Then increase temperature to 200 degC/392 Fahrenheit and bake for approximately half an hour, until top is golden brown, and the loaves sound hollow when tapped.
    1. Turn out onto a wire rack to cool. The bread will keep fresh for three or four days. It can also be pre-sliced (use a sharp serrated knife to cut into 14 slices per loaf) and frozen in a plastic bag to be used as you need
